Our Food Shelf Is Empty","teacherDisplayName":"Ms. Zucker","teacherPhotoUrl":"https://storage.donorschoose.net/dc_prod/images/teacher/profile/orig/tp8699177_orig.jpg?crop=1:1,smart&width=272&height=272&fit=bounds&auto=webp&t=1753146807964","teacherClassroomUrl":"classroom/8699177"},{"teacherId":9798935,"projectId":10064558,"letterContent":"My chemistry students thoroughly enjoyed using the new equipment and supplies you donated for performing titrations. Part of the allure of chemistry is the interesting glassware, and their jaws dropped when they first saw the buret tubes! \r\n\r\nPerforming titrations, understanding the concept, and completing the calculations are all new and challenging experiences for these students. Once they got a handle on the theory, they started the titrations, but I could tell they needed to run the investigation several times to really understand what they were doing. As the class was coming to an end, I asked \"should we do this again next class?\" The answer was a resounding \"yes!\".\r\n\r\nThe next day we met, they went straight to work performing the titration. Most of them got incredibly close to the actual endpoint, the point at which the volume of base exactly neutralizes the acid. From there, they calculated the concentration of the acid.\r\n\r\nThey are now aware how important titrations are to many industries, and in particular, the food and beverage industry. About this school
Pahoa High & Intermediate School is
a rural public school
in Pahoa, Hawaii that is part of Hawaii School District.
It serves 745 students
in grades 7 - 12 with a student/teacher ratio of 21.9:1.
Its teachers have had 235 projects funded on DonorsChoose.
